So sharing permissions are different depending on what pathway the user takes. Or, there’s ‘Manage Access’, which will add someone directly to a file.īut, when you open a file in OneDrive and go to share it, it uses this first share functionality, not ‘Manage Access’. If you right-click on a document in OneDrive, it allows you to share via a link with a select group of people. For an end user, this makes the interface easier to use as it instills familiarity.įor OneDrive, it offers two different forms of sharing, which can be confusing for users.
With Google Drive, if you look at file sharing, whether it be within the ‘File Manager’ or the document itself – the screen that you’re presented with using both pathways is the exact same. Beyond 25 TB, storage is provisioned as 25 TB SharePoint team sites to individual users.Google Drive and Microsoft OneDrive are the most popular online storage solutions out there. Storage up to 25 TB/user is provisioned in OneDrive for Business. Request additional storage by contacting Microsoft support. Microsoft will initially provide 1 TB/user of OneDrive for Business storage, which admins can increase to 5 TB/user. *Unlimited individual cloud storage for qualifying plans for subscriptions of five or more users, otherwise 1 TB/user.
